Arsenal legend Ian Wright has this evening taken to social media to suggest that his former side should make a move for soon-to-be free agent midfielder Daniele De Rossi.

Roma icon

Italian veteran De Rossi has long stood as one of the most-recognisable figures in Serie A.

The 35-year-old has spent his entire career to date on the books of boyhood club AS Roma, after joining the Giallorossi’s youth setup as a talented youngster in 2000.

Two weeks ago, though, following 19 long, passion-filled years at the Stadio Olimpico, De Rossi took to the pitch for the final time in Roma’s colours.

After almost two decades personifying the Gladiator spirit at the heart of the capital outfit’s midfield, across over 600 appearances, it was confirmed earlier this month that the 2006 World Cup winner’s contract would not be renewed this summer.

As such, the 1st of July will see De Rossi become a free agent for the first time in his career.

As things stand, it is unclear what the combative midfielder’s plans for his next move are, with a potential MLS switch having been touted of late.

In addition, Roma president James Pallotta has confirmed that the club’s doors ‘will remain open for him to return in a new role whenever he wants.’

One individual who is of the opinion that De Rossi’s career is not yet finished at the top level, though, is Ian Wright.

As mentioned above, the Arsenal legend has this evening taken to Twitter to urge the north Londoners’ board to make a move for the Italian, insisting that the experience he would introduce to Unai Emery’s squad would be ‘invaluable’:
